The Babar Azam vs Virat Kohli debate has been going on for quite some time now. Although, the Indian cricketer has been one of the best batters of this century but things are not really working out for him at the moment.

It is without a shadow of doubt that Babar Azam has been a better player than Virat Kohli in the last year or so. And the two cricketers’ International Cricket Council (ICC) batting rankings across the three formats speak for themselves.

In the latest ICC rankings in tests, ODIs and T20Is, Babar Azam has left behind his Indian counterpart. In the red ball cricket, Babar Azam is ranked at number eight while the Indian cricketer is ranked at number 9.

Similarly, Babar also leads Kohli in the white ball cricket. The Pakistani skipper is the number one ODI batsman while Virat Kohli is a spot below him at number 2. In T20 cricket, Kohli is no way near Babar as the Pakistani batter is ranked at number two while the Indian cricketer isn’t even in the top 10 of the ICC T20 batting ranking.

Babar Azam has so far represented Pakistan cricket team in 37 tests, 83 ODIs and 73 T20Is. He averages 43.18 in tests, 56.93 in ODIs and 45.17 in T20Is. He has a total of 20 centuries and 61 half centuries  to his name across the three formats.
